To submit a claim with your insurance provider, have your policy number and be ready to share the kind of residential or commercial property claim and the involved loss. Then, call your representative. The agent will discuss what is covered and may set up an assessment of the residential or commercial property to examine the loss and approximate the cost to cover it. Do not attempt to clean up an item or a location until the agent has actually looked at your home. Likewise, record the damage or other loss with photographs.

Occupants insurance coverage is a policy designed to assist secure you financially if you lease a house, home or condominium. It pays to replace or repair your belongings, up to your policy limits, must they be harmed or taken. Additionally, tenants insurance coverage assists spend for repair work if you inadvertently damage others' property. It also spends for a guest's medical bills if you're discovered responsible for his or her injuries. And, it generally consists of additional living expenditures, which assists pay for costs such as hotel expenses, if your rental becomes uninhabitable due to fire or some other disaster.

Some states are more expensive than others when it comes to what you pay. Compared to the national average of $326 for home occupants insurance, New Jersey, Tennessee and Utah have to do with average for that coverage level. Vermont and Wyoming are the least expensive, at about $160 a year. Here are typical rental insurance costs by state, so you have a concept what Helpful resources you'll pay. If you are a college student living off campus, or do not have a lot of valuable ownerships or other properties, then you may find appropriate defense with a really bare-bones policy offering an optimum of $12,000 to change lost, stolen or harmed products. The protection would include $100,000 for liability, which is necessary in case someone is seriously injured in your house and strikes you with a lawsuit and legally attempts to be reimbursed for medical expenditures. A minimum policy like this often has a $500 deductible and generally costs around $100 a year, perhaps a little bit more or less, depending upon a couple of factors, consisting of where you live and your credit rating.
